Bollinger Shipyards Inc. has successfully completed the retrofit of a 360-foot Penn Maritime oceans tank barge, the POTOMAC, to meet the Oil Pollution Act standards of 1990.


This act was pushed through litigation soon after the Exxon Valdez incident. According to Robert Socha, executive vice president of marketing and sales at Bollinger, the act mandates that all vessels will be double-hulled by 2014.

The vessel arrived at Bollinger’s New Orleans east facility as a 360-foot single hulled barge with the capacity to hold 66,500 barrels of petroleum products, he said.


The vessel’s stern was modified and outfitted with the Beacon JAK connection system. Its heating system was revamped by the addition of heating coils and a new 12 million BTU Vampower unit, Socha explained. A ballast system and a 12-foot bow plug, along with an updated electrical system were part of the conversions.


The POTOMAC departed Bollinger’s port as a double-hulled 372-foot vessel with the capacity to carry 80,000 barrels.

Bollinger’s Executive Vice President Ben Bordelon said, “Our communications with the customer, and our dedicated employees were the key to the successful completion of this project. I cannot say enough about Penn and their team and their team who supported Bollinger, and helped to make this program a success.”

With the re-delivery of the fully OPA ’90 compliant POTOMAC, Bollinger picked up another contract from Penn Maritime for similar conversions.

Socha said, “The other barge is in-route to the shipyard right now.”

Bollinger has several other contracts to do similar conversions, according to Socha. “It’s highly specialized, and we have quite a few more conversions under way,” he said.
